Data Protection Charter

The data collected by Latabledulodge.com ?

Constitutes a personal data any information allowing to identify you directly or indirectly, as for example the name, first name(s), date of birth, age, sex, e-mail address, postal address or telephone number. As the case may be, Latabledulodge.com processes your personal data, directly collected from you or resulting from the use of the services. Latabledulodge.com is also likely to be recipient of data which were collected from you by a third provider in connection with the restoration.

La Table du Lodge collects and processes the following categories of data:

  • Data to identify you: First name + Last name + Company
  • Contact data: Email, cell phone number
  • Data of connection, of use of the services: Logs of connection, of acceptance of the General Conditions, of acceptance of the Charter.

About cookies and anonymous data

We also collect certain technical and anonymous data from you in an automatic and declared manner, in particular your IP address, the dates and times of your visits and the pages consulted. This data does not allow us to identify you directly or indirectly and is used to better understand the behavior of everyone on the sites of La Table du Lodge in order to improve and simplify navigation on these sites.

About IP addresses: we collect and process IP addresses for statistical purposes, verification and validation of clicks within the framework of our activity and control of their use within the framework of a file declared to the CNIL. These are processed in compliance with the principles of personal data protection defined by the legislation in force.

N.B.: The User ID and Site configuration allow you to post data to your Facebook profile. If you choose to post data, the posts will only be available to those who can see your profile updates on Facebook.

About cookies

Cookies are used as part of the use of the site. The user has the possibility to deactivate the cookies from the settings of his browser.

All this anonymous data is deleted after 13 months.

When you create your profile on the Site, your computer records coded data that is sent to it by our services. This data is stored in a small file called a cookie. It is this cookie that allows us to recognize you when you connect to the Site and that allows us to personalize the information we provide. However, none of the data about you that appears in the session cookie is stored and/or processed by La Table du Lodge and its partners. We also use security cookies to authenticate users, prevent fraudulent use of login information and protect user data from unauthorized third parties.

La Table du Lodge and its partners also use :

Session cookies, which may be used to maintain user data during browsing, but also across multiple visits.
Tracking Cookies (Google Analytics) which record coded data to which La Table du Lodge and its partners do not have access but which allow us to propose offers on other communication media and to collect statistics for the monitoring of the website.
Marketing cookies: La Table du Lodge and its service providers use the services of affiliate companies or webmarketing, which are likely to deposit cookies for technical statistics, advertising, affiliate services and display advertising (eg Google, Facebook ...). These companies are likely to deposit and read their own cookies on which we have no information, nor any sharing.

What are your rights and how do you exercise them?

At any time, you can:

Request a copy of the personal data we hold about you

Inform us of any changes to your personal data, or ask us to amend any personal data we hold about you

In certain situations, you may ask us to erase, block or restrict the processing of your personal data, or to object to certain of our methods of processing your personal data

In certain situations, you may also ask us to send the personal data you have provided to us to a third party

When we use your personal data following your agreement, you have the right to revoke it at any time, in accordance with the law in force.

In addition, when processing your personal data for legitimate or public interest purposes, you may at any time refuse that we use your personal data subject to the applicable law

You may also ask us at any time to stop receiving advertisements by contacting us directly and free of charge, or by using the unsubscribe link included in any prospecting we may send you by e-mail.
